From e37e6df7758c3bbb2757be1717636e98169dcb1c Mon Sep 17 00:00:00 2001 From: aarne Date: Mon, 22 Nov 2010 22:41:29 +0000 Subject: [PATCH] lang flag in align_words sets the list of languages --- src/compiler/GF/Command/Commands.hs |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/compiler/GF/Command/Commands.hs b/src/compiler/GF/Command/Commands.hs index b4ab5ff4a..48f9b4f49 100644 --- a/src/compiler/GF/Command/Commands.hs +++ b/src/compiler/GF/Command/Commands.hs @@ -151,7 +151,8 @@ allCommands env@(pgf, mos) = Map.fromList [ "flag -format." ], exec = \opts es -> do - let grph = if null es then [] else graphvizAlignment pgf (languages pgf) (head es) + let langs = optLangs opts + let grph = if null es then [] else graphvizAlignment pgf langs (head es) if isFlag "view" opts || isFlag "format" opts then do let file s = "_grph." ++ s let view = optViewGraph opts @@ -169,7 +170,8 @@ allCommands env@(pgf, mos) = Map.fromList [ ], flags = [ ("format","format of the visualization file (default \"png\")"), - ("view","program to open the resulting file (default \"open\")") + ("lang", "alignments for this list of languages (default: all)"), + ("view", "program to open the resulting file (default \"open\")") ] }), ("ga", emptyCommandInfo {